- The distance between Verhojansk, Russia and Poprad, Slovakia is approximately 5,908 km or 3,671 mi.
- To reach Verhojansk in this distance one would set out from Poprad bearing 26°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Verhojansk bearing 131.1° or SE .
- Verhojansk has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season and extremely severe winters (Dfd) whereas Poprad has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Verhojansk is in or near the subpolar dry tundra biome whereas Poprad is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 21.1 °C (38°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 41.7 °C (75.1°F) more in Verhojansk.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 402.4 mm (15.8 in) less which is equivalent to 402.4 l/m² (9.88 US gal/ft²) or 4,024,000 l/ha (430,192 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.4° lower in Verhojansk than in Poprad.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 21.5°C (38.7°F) lower.
